Why Choose Small Tube Amplifiers

Before diving into our top picks, let’s explore the difference between tube amplifiers and small hybrid tube amplifiers. Traditional tube amplifiers are known for their warm, natural sound but can be bulky and expensive. small hybrid tube amplifiers, on the other hand, combine the best of both worlds – the classic tube warmth and a more compact, budget-friendly design.

Small tube amplifiers offer a cost-effective solution for audiophiles seeking both performance and affordability. Their compact design, often with simplified circuitry and fewer components, contributes to a streamlined manufacturing process, resulting in lower production costs. Additionally, the energy-efficient nature of small tube amplifiers, operating on lower wattage, not only saves electricity but also reduces overall costs. Some models embrace hybrid designs, combining tube warmth with solid-state components, achieving a desirable audio experience at a more accessible price point.

Direct-to-consumer models, skipping traditional retail channels, further contribute to cost savings, allowing consumers to enjoy high-quality sound without unnecessary markups. With a focus on essential features, these small tube amplifiers provide a cost-effective alternative for budget-conscious buyers, proving that exceptional audio quality can be achieved without breaking the bank.

2. Aiyima T9 Pro HiFi Tube Amplifier

The Aiyima T9 is an exceptional amplifier that delivers exceptional sound quality and boasts a minimalist design that is both sleek and elegant. With a powerful class D amplifier and tube preamp, it combines efficiency with warmth for a superior audio experience. 

The aluminum alloy chassis further enhances durability while adding a touch of sophistication to your audio setup. The Aiyima T9 Pro is an upgraded version that utilizes the TPA3250 chip and delivers a maximum power of 100W per channel. It is also incredibly versatile and affordable, making it the perfect choice for any audio enthusiast.

Pros: Compact design, efficient class D amplifier, sleek aluminum construction.

Cons: Limited connectivity options, may not suit audiophiles seeking extensive customization.

3. Fosi Audio T20X Tube Amplifier

The Fosi Audio T20X is an exceptional choice for audio enthusiasts who demand versatility in their audio gear. With a range of inputs including Bluetooth 5.0, USB, and RCA, this amplifier can handle virtually any audio source you throw at it. The T20X boasts intuitive treble and bass adjustments, and with its tube preamp stage, it offers an immersive and customized listening experience.

Its 100 watt per channel output provides jaw-dropping sound, and the TPA3221 Class-D amplifier ensures efficient operation at idle, standby, and full power. The 5654W tube is known for its warm sound, and adds a pleasing bass boost that is sure to impress even the most discerning audiophile.

Pros: Multiple input options, customizable sound with tone controls.

Cons: Build quality might not match high-end alternatives, and some users may desire more power.

5. Dayton Audio HTA100BT Hybrid Tube Amplifier

The Dayton Audio HTA100BT is a remarkable amplifier that is perfect for music lovers. It combines modern features with the classic sound of vacuum tubes to create an incredible listening experience.

The addition of Bluetooth connectivity means that you can easily connect your audio sources wirelessly, making it more convenient and versatile than ever before. The amplifier also has a built-in phono preamplifier that makes it easy to connect record players, and its class AB amplifier efficiency produces an articulate and natural sound that really brings your music to life. 

The brushed aluminum housing with vintage front panel VU meters gives it a clean, modern look that pays respects to classic aesthetics. Overall, the Dayton Audio HTA100BT is a must-have for any serious music enthusiast.

Pros: Bluetooth Connectivity, Compact Design, Versatile Inputs, Tube Preamp Stage

Cons: Limited Power Output, Limited Customization, Price
